Gillemot Foundation Awards $1 Million Grant to Create Aviation Technology Program at AACT High School

The Gillemot Foundation has provided a grant of $1,009,350 to transform existing facilities at the Academy of Arts, Careers & Technology (AACT) into a state-of-the-art learning center focused on aviation technology.
